Honestly, the apps I have tried all had serious flaws...especially when it comes to intensity techniques.

There are never any ways to reliable and easily record drop sets, rest pause, etc. It can also be difficult at times to differentiate between warm ups and actual working sets.

Yeah I would echo this. He apps I’ve seen didnt offer the flexibility for different rep schemes, drop sets, etc. They’re usually more of a straight x sets x xreps and that’s it.
